  41. 26. Discussion and possible action regarding approval for the renewal of the CCSO Flock Agreement through InSight Public Sector, Inc. The agreement is for the Flock Group Falcon Infrastructure-Power Plus, license plate recognition camera with vehicle fingerprint plus machine learning software and real-alerts. The coverage dates are December 28, 2025 through December 27, 2026. The total annual cost is $60,000. Chairman McHughes stated that from a non-attorney perspective, there does not appear to be clear statutory authorization, and the issue falls into a gray area. However, support is being given at this time based on the District Attorney’s favorable opinion. Future support cannot be guaranteed. Legislative approval is needed because the authority is not clearly defined. While it is recognized as a strong public safety measure, it should be formally codified into law. It is recommended that the Sheriff’s Office work with the OSA or the District Attorney’s office to file a bill to ensure this authority is clearly established in statute. 26-0059 postponed Pass ▶ jump to 18:59
